The Significance of OCR in the Retail Sector

OCR Data Collection technology empowers retailers to convert invoices and receipts into digital formats, streamlining the data extraction process. The primary advantages include:

  • Automated Data Entry: This feature removes the need for manual data input, thereby minimizing errors and enhancing operational efficiency.
  • Expense Monitoring: It assists businesses in categorizing expenses and analyzing spending trends.
  • Fraud Prevention: The technology detects discrepancies and potential fraudulent activities within transactions.
  • Inventory Oversight: The data obtained supports the monitoring of stock levels and supplier interactions.
  • Consumer Insights: It offers a more profound understanding of customer purchasing patterns.

Extracting Essential Information from Invoices and Receipts

OCR-enabled systems can effectively retrieve vital information such as:

  • Invoice Number and Date: Critical for maintaining records and conducting audits.
  • Vendor or Supplier Details: Aids in managing supplier relations and processing payments.
  • Detailed Purchases: Captures product names, quantities, and pricing information.
  • Taxes and Discounts: Assists in ensuring tax compliance and evaluating promotional strategies.
  • Total Transaction Value: Facilitates financial reconciliation and expense assessment.

Challenges in OCR Data Extraction for Retail

While OCR technology offers significant benefits, its application in the retail sector is not without obstacles:

  • Handwritten and Poor-Quality Scans: Inconsistencies in handwriting and subpar receipt quality can hinder accuracy.
  • Varied Formatting: Retailers employ a multitude of invoice and receipt formats, necessitating flexible OCR models.
  • Data Privacy Issues: Adhering to data protection regulations is essential when managing customer data.
  • Immediate Processing Requirements: Retailers demand prompt data extraction to facilitate swift decision-making.

Addressing OCR Challenges with AI and Machine Learning

Sophisticated OCR solutions utilize AI and machine learning to enhance both accuracy and efficiency. Notable improvements include:

  • Natural Language Processing (NLP): Aids in understanding context and refining data classification.
  • Machine Learning Algorithms: Enhance OCR capabilities by training on a wide range of invoice and receipt formats.
  • Cloud-Based OCR Solutions: Improve scalability and enable real-time data processing.

Integration with ERP and POS Systems: Facilitates smooth data transfer, thereby boosting business intelligence.
